‘നിങ്ങളുടെ ജീവിതത്തിൽ അത്ഭുതങ്ങളൊന്നും സംഭവിക്കില്ലെന്നു തിരിച്ചറിയുമ്പോൾ സ്വയം അത്ഭുതമായി മാറുക.’ ലോക പ്രശസ്ത മോട്ടിവേഷനൽ സ്പീക്കർ നിക് വുജിസിക്കിന്റെ ആത്മകഥയായ ‘ലൈഫ് വിതൗട്ട് ലിമിറ്റ്സ്’ എന്ന പുസ്തകത്തിലെ ആദ്യ അധ്യായത്തിന്റെ തലക്കെട്ടാണിത്. ഈ വാക്കുകൾ ഇന്നു ലോകത്തോടു പറയാൻ ഏറ്റവും അനു‌യോജ്യനായ വ്യക്തിയാണ് നിക്കോളാസ് ജയിംസ് വുജിസിക് എന്ന നിക് വുജിസിക്. കാരണം, ജീവിച്ചിരിക്കുന്ന ഒരു അത്ഭുതമാണ് ഇദ്ദേഹം.

കൈകളും കാലുകളുമില്ലാതെ ജനിച്ച നിക് വുജിസിക് ഇതുവരെ 63 രാജ്യങ്ങൾ സന്ദർശിക്കുകയും പ്രഭാഷണങ്ങളിലൂടെ ലക്ഷക്കണക്കിന് ആളുകൾക്കു പ്രചോദനമായി മാറുകയും ചെയ്തു. സെർബിയയിൽ നിന്ന് ഓസ്ട്രേലിയയിലേക്ക് കുടിയേറിയ പാസ്റ്റർ ബോറിസ് വുജിസിക്കിന്റെയും നഴ്സായ ദുഷ്ക വുജിസിക്കിന്റെയും മൂത്ത മകനാണ് നിക്. 1982 ഡിസംബർ 4ന് ടെട്രാ അമീലിയ സിൻഡ്രം എന്ന അസുഖവുമായാണ് അദ്ദേഹം ജനിച്ചത്.

തങ്ങളുടെ മകന്റെ ഭാവിയോർത്ത് ആ മാതാപിതാക്കൾ ഏറെ ദുഖിച്ചെങ്കിലും നിക്കിന്റെ പരിചരണത്തിനും, വളർച്ചയ്ക്കുമായാണ് പിന്നീടുള്ള ജീവിതം അവർ മാറ്റി വച്ചത്. ആരോൺ, മൈക്കിൾ എന്നിങ്ങനെ 2 അനുജന്മാരാണ് നിക്കിനുള്ളത്.

കൈകാലുകളില്ലാത്ത മകനെ സാധാരണ കുട്ടികൾക്കൊപ്പം അവർ സ്കൂളിൽ ചേർത്തു. ഒരു അപൂർവ ജീവി എന്ന വിധത്തിലാണ് സഹപാഠികളും പുറംലോകവും അവനെ കണ്ടത്. ഭ്രാന്തനെന്നും അന്യഗ്രഹ ജീവിയെന്നും വിളിച്ചു കളിയാക്കി. അപമാനം സഹിക്കാനാകാതെ 10ാം വയസിൽ ആത്മഹത്യയെക്കുറിച്ചുവരെ ചിന്തിച്ചിട്ടുണ്ടെന്നു നിക് പറയുന്നു.

എല്ലാ രാത്രിയിലും കിടക്കുന്നതിനു മുൻപ് നിക് പ്രാർഥിച്ചിരുന്നു, ഉണരുമ്പോഴേക്കു തനിക്ക് കൈകാലുകൾ തരണമേയെന്ന്. എന്നാൽ ആ അത്ഭുതം ഒരിക്കലും നടന്നില്ല. ജീവിതത്തിൽ അത്ഭുതങ്ങൾ സംഭവിക്കില്ലെന്നു തിരിച്ചറിഞ്ഞതോടെ നിക് സ്വയം അത്ഭുത‌മാകാൻ തീരുമാനിച്ചു.

തന്റെ ജന്മത്തിന്റെ അർഥം എന്താണെന്നു തിരിച്ചറിയാനാകാതെ വിഷമിച്ചു നടന്ന കാലം അദ്ദേഹത്തിന്റെ ജീവിതത്തെ മാറ്റി മറിച്ച ഒരു സംഭവമുണ്ടായി. അന്ന് നിക്കിന് 15 വയസ്. കലിഫോർണിയയിലെ ഒരു പള്ളിയിൽ നിന്ന് ജീവിതാനുഭവങ്ങൾ പങ്കു വയ്ക്കാൻ നിക്കിന് ക്ഷണം ലഭിച്ചു. അവിടെ അദ്ദേഹത്തെ ശ്രവിക്കാനായി ഒരു കുടുംബം എത്തിയിരുന്നു. നിക്കിനെ പോലെ കാലുകളും കൈകളുമില്ലാതെ ജനിച്ച ഡാനിയൽ എന്ന കുഞ്ഞുമായാണ് അവർ പള്ളിയിൽ എത്തിയത്. ആ കുഞ്ഞിൽ നിക്  തന്നെ കണ്ടു. അവിടെ വച്ച് നിക് വുജിസിക് തന്റെ ജീവിത ലക്ഷ്യം തിരിച്ചറിയുകയായിരുന്നു. അദ്ദേഹം ഒരു പ്രഭാഷകനായി മാറി. ജീവിതത്തിന്റെ വെല്ലുവിളികളെ സധൈര്യം നേരിടാൻ സഹായിക്കുന്ന, ആളുകൾക്ക് വലിയ പ്രത്യാശയും, പ്രചോദനവും പകർന്നു നൽകുന്ന ഒരു മോട്ടിവേഷനൽ സ്പീക്കർ.

nick-family

ഹൈസ്‌കൂൾ പഠനത്തിനു ശേഷം നിക് ടെറിട്ടറി എജ്യുക്കേഷനിൽ നിന്ന് ഡിഗ്രി ബിരുദവും ഓസ്‌ട്രേലിയയിലെ ഗ്രിഫിത് സർവകലാശാലയിൽ നിന്ന് അക്കൗണ്ടിങ് ആൻഡ് ഫിനാൻഷ്യൽ പ്ലാനിങ്ങിൽ ബിരുദവും നേടി.

വൈകല്യവുമായി ജനിച്ച ആളുകൾക്കു പ്രചോദനമേകാൻ 2005ൽ നിക് ‘ലൈഫ് വിതൗട് ലിംബ്സ്’ എന്ന സ്ഥാപനം ആരംഭിച്ചു. ‘ആറ്റിറ്റ്യൂഡ് ഈസ് ഓൾട്ടിറ്റ്യൂഡ്’ എന്ന മോട്ടിവേഷനൽ സ്പീക്കിങ് കമ്പനി 2007ൽ തുടങ്ങി.

ടെക്സസ് സ്വദേശിയായ കാനേ മിയാഹരെയെ 2012ൽ നിക് ജീവിത പങ്കാളിയാക്കി. ഇരുവർക്കും 4 കുട്ടികളാണുള്ളത്. ദൈനംദിന കാര്യങ്ങൾ  ചെയ്യാൻ അദ്ദേഹത്തിന് ആരുടെയും സഹായം വേണ്ട. ഗോൾഫ് , നീന്തൽ, സർഫിങ്, സ്കൈ ഡൈവിങ് തുടങ്ങി ഒരു സാധാരണ മനുഷ്യനു ചെയ്യാൻ സാധിക്കുന്നതെല്ലാം നിക് ചെയ്യും.

 ലൈഫ് വിതൗട്ട് ലിമിറ്റ്‌സ്, അൺ സ്റ്റോപ്പബിൾ, ലിമിറ്റ്‌ലെസ്, സ്റ്റാൻഡ് സ്‌ട്രോങ് ആൻഡ് ലൗവ് വിത്തൗട്ട് ലിമിറ്റ്‌സ്, ബി ദ് ഹാൻഡ്സ് ആൻഡ് ഫീറ്റ് എന്നീ പുസ്തകങ്ങൾ രചിച്ചു. അദ്ദേഹത്തിന്റെ രചനകൾ മുപ്പതിലേറെ ഭാഷകളിലേക്കു വിവർത്തനം ചെയ്തിട്ടുണ്ട്.

 യൂ ട്യൂബിൽ അദ്ദേഹത്തിന്റെ ഓരോ വിഡിയോയും ലക്ഷക്കണക്കിനാളുകളാണ് കാണുന്നത്. സ്വന്തം കഴിവിൽ വിശ്വസിച്ചാൽ നേട്ടങ്ങൾ സ്വന്തമാക്കാം എന്ന് നിക് പ്രസംഗിക്കുകയല്ല, ജീവിച്ചു കാണിക്കുകയാണ്. അതുകൊണ്ടു തന്നെ ഈ 36 കാരന്റെ ജീവിതത്തെ ലൈഫ് വിതൗട് ലിമിറ്റ്സ് എന്നു തന്നെ വിശേഷിപ്പിക്കാം.

  • Nick Vujicic was born to Dushka and Boris Vujicic in 1982 in Melbourne, Australia. Although he was an otherwise healthy baby, Nick was born without arms and legs; he had no legs, but two small feet, one of which had two toes. Nick has two siblings, Michelle and Aaron. Initially, a Victoria state law prevented Nick from attending a mainstream school due to his physical disability in spite of a lack of mental impairment. However, Vujicic became one of the first physically disabled students integrated into a mainstream school once those laws changed. However, his lack of limbs made him a target for school bullies, and he fell into a severe depression. At age eight, he contemplated suicide and even tried to drown himself in his bathtub at age ten; his love for his parents prevented him from following through. He also stated in his music video "Something More" that God had a plan for his life and he could not bring himself to drown because of this. Nick prayed very hard that God would give him arms and legs, and initially told God that, if his prayer remained unanswered, Nick would not praise him indefinitely. However, a key turning point in his faith came when his mother showed him a newspaper article about a man dealing with a severe disability. Vujicic realized he wasn't unique in his struggles and began to embrace his lack of limbs. After this, Nick realized his accomplishments could inspire others and became grateful for his life. Nick gradually figured out how to live a full life without limbs, adapting many of the daily skills limbed people accomplish without thinking. Nick writes with two toes on his left foot and a special grip that slid onto his big toe. He knows how to use a computer and can type up to 45 words per minute using the "heel and toe" method. He has also learned to throw tennis balls, play drum pedals, get a glass of water, comb his hair, brush his teeth, answer the phone and shave, in addition to participating in golf, swimming, and even sky-diving. During secondary school, he was elected captain of MacGregor State in Queensland and worked with the student council on fundraising events for local charities and disability campaigns. When he was seventeen, he started to give talks at his prayer group, and later founded his non-profit organization, Life Without Limbs. - IMDb Mini Biography By: Anonymous

ඔබ වාසනාවන්තද අවාසනාවන්තද? ඒ ප්‍රශ්නයට පිළිතුරක් මේ මොහොතේ තිබුණත් නැතත් ජීවිතයේ කවදාහරි දවසක “මං මහා අවාසනාවන්තයෙක්” කියලා ඔබට හිතිලා තියෙනවද? තමන්ට “අවාසනාවන්තකමේ” ලේබල් අලවගන්න කලින් දෑත් දෙපා දෙකම අහිමිව උපන් ඕස්ට්‍රේලියානු ජාතික නික් වුයිචිච් ගැන කියන මේ ලිපිය කියවලා බලන්න.

අපි එකිනෙකාගේ ආශාවන් විවිධයි. “මට ඒ දේ තිබුණා නම්! මේ දේවල් මීට වඩා වෙනස් වුණා නම්, මට මේ මේ දේවල් නැහැ, ඒ නිසා මට මේක කරන්න බැහැ” ඔන්න ඔහොම අපි හිතනවා නේද? අපි මේ දේවල් ගැන ළතවෙන්නම මෙච්චර කාලය නාස්ති කරන්නෙ කොයි තරම් දේවල් හිමි වෙලා තියෙද්දිද? අත් පා ඔබටත් මටත් උපතින්ම හිමි වුණු දේවල්. ඒත් නිකලස් ජේම්ස් වුයිචිච් උපතින්ම දෑත් දෙපා අහිමි පුද්ගලයෙක්.

1982 දෙසැම්බර් 4 වැනිදා ඕස්ට්‍රේලියාවේ මෙල්බන්හිදී නික් ඉපදුණේ ඉතා කලාතුරකින් දක්නට ලැබෙන ටෙට්‍රා ඇමේලියා සහලක්ෂණය උරුම කරගෙනයි. ටෙට්‍රා ඇමේලියා තත්ත්වයේදී පුද්ගලයාට ගාත්‍රා හතරම අහිමි වෙනවා. නික්ටත් ඔහුගේ අත් පා කිසිවක් නැහැ.

nick vujicic biography in tamil

නික් කුඩා කල ඔහුගේ පියා සමඟ (Fatherly)

ටෙට්‍රා ඇමේලියා සහලක්ෂණය

මෙය ඉතා දුලබ තත්ත්වයක්. මෙහිදී පුද්ගලයාට උපතින්ම සියළු ගාත්‍රා අහිමි වෙනවා. ටෙට්‍රා (Tetra) යන ග්‍රීක වචනයේ අරුත 4 යන්නයි. ඇමේලියා (Amelia) යන්නෙන් අදහස් වන්නේ උපතට පෙර අත හෝ පාදය වර්ධනය නොවීමයි. මෙම තත්ත්වය මුහුණ, හදවත, ස්නායු පද්ධතිය, අස්ථි පද්ධතිය, පෙනහළු සහ ලිංගික අවයව වැනි ශරීරයේ අනෙක් ස්ථාන වලටත් බලපාන්නට පුළුවන්. ටෙට්‍රා ඇමේලියා සහලක්ෂණය සහිතව උපදින බොහෝ දරුවන් දරුණු සෞඛ්‍ය ගැටළු වලට මුහුණ දෙන අතර ඔවුන් උපතට පෙර මියයාම හෝ උපන් විගසම මියයාම සිදු වෙනවා. මෙම තත්ත්වය තිබියදී ජීවත් වන පිරිස ඉතාමත් අඩුයි.

“මගේ මව වින්නඹුවක්. ඇයට දරු උපත පිළිබඳව පරිපූර්ණ දැනුමක් තිබෙනවා. ගැබ් කාලයේදී මොනයම් හෝ වරදක් ඇති බව දැණුනු නිසා ඇය එයට අදාල සියළු පරීක්ෂණ කර තිබුණත් මගේ කිසිදු අසම්පූර්ණ බවක් ඒවායේ සටහන් වී තිබුණේ නැහැ. ඒ නිසා අත් පා නැතිව මා ඉපදුණු විට එය ඇයට මහත් කම්පනයක් වී තිබුණා.” නික් ඔහු පිළිබඳව ඔහුගේ මවගේ අත්දැකීම විස්තර කර තිබුණේ එසේයි.

අත් පා අහිමිව උපන් තම දරුවා දුටු නික්ගේ පියා කලාන්ත වීමට ආසන්නව වූ බවත් ඔහුගේ මව ඇගෙන් නික්ව ඉවත් කරන ලෙසත්, ඔහු දෙස බැලීමට උවමනා නැති බවත් පැවසූ බව සඳහන් වෙනවා. නමුත් නික්ගේ පියා ඔහු පියකරු දරුවකු බව වුයිචිච් මහත්මිය සනසමින් පවසා තිබෙනවා. නික්ව  නිවසට ගෙන ගිය පසු ඔහුගේ මවට ඔහුට හුරු වීමට මාස 4ක් පමණ ගත වී තිබෙනවා.

අසීරු පාසල් කාලය

නික් ඔහුගේ ආබාධිත තත්ත්වය නිසා පාසලේදී සම වයස් දරුවන්ගේ අඩම්තේට්ටම් සහ හිරිහැර කිරීම් වලට ලක්වුණා. ඔවුන් කරන කියන දේ නොසලකා හරින ලෙස ඔහුගේ දෙමව්පියන් පැවසුවත් නික්ට සුවිශේෂ ළමයෙකු වීමට අවශ්‍යතාවයක් තිබුණේ නැහැ. ඔහුටත් අනෙක් අයට මෙන්ම අත් පා අවශ්‍ය වුණා. තමන්ට පමණක් දෑත් දෙපා අහිමිව ඇත්තේ ඇයි දැයි කුඩා නික් නිතරම කල්පනා කළා.

වෙනත් සිසුවෙකු නික්ට සමච්චල් කිරීමේදී හෝ ක්‍රීඩාවකින් ඉවත් කිරීමේදී ඔහුට මහත් අසරණ බවක් සහ තනිකමක් දැණුනා. තමන් කිසිවිටෙක ඔහුව අතනොහරින බව දෙමව්පියන් නික්ට පැවසුවත් පාසලේදී මුහුණ දීමට සිදුවන මේ අප්‍රසන්න තත්ත්වය ක්‍රම ක්‍රමයෙන් ඔහුව විෂාදය දක්වා ගෙන ඒමට සමත් වුණා. ආරක්ෂාවක් ඇති එකම ස්ථානය ලෙස ඔහු දුටුවේ නිවස පමණයි.

“විශාල දොම්නසකින් සහ තනිකමකින් පෙළුණු මට වයස අවුරුදු 10දී සියදිවි හානි කර ගැනීමට උවමනා වුණා. මම කිසි වැඩකට නැති අයෙක් ලෙසත්, දෙමව්පියන්ට මහත් කරදරයක් බවත්, මට කිසිදාක විවාහ වන්නට නොලැබෙන බවත් හැඟුණා. මේ සියළු දේවල් සිතුණේ මම තවත් මා වැනිම අත් පා නැති පිරිමි ළමයෙකු දකිනකම් පමණයි.” එම අත්දැකීම ඔහු විස්තර කරන්නේ එලෙසයි.

‘Life without Limbs’

nick vujicic biography in tamil

ඔහු දේශනයක් අතරතුරදී (SPEAKING.com)

නික් වයස අවුරුදු 17දී පමණ ‘Life Without Limbs’ නමින් ආයතනයක් පිහිටෙව්වා. අවුරුදු 19 පටන් ඔහු ධෛර්යයමත් කිරීමේ දේශන පැවැත්වීම ඇරඹූ අතර ලොව පුරා බොහෝ මිනිසුන් සමඟ ඔහු ඔහුගේ බලාපොරොත්තුවේ පණිවුඩය බෙදා ගත්තා. ඔහු දැනට රටවල් 58කට අධික ප්‍රමාණයක සංචාරය කර තිබෙනවා. ඔහු අමතන පිරිස් අතර ව්‍යාපාරික කණ්ඩායම්, ගුරුවරුන්, තරුණයන්, පාසල් සහ විශ්ව විද්‍යාල සිසුන් වැනි බොහෝ දෙනා ඇතළත් වෙනවා.

“තරුණ පරම්පරාවට කතා කිරීම බොහොම විනෝදජනකයි. ඔවුන්ගේ වටිනාකම් සහ අරමුණු පිළිබඳව කතා කරමින් ඔවුන් ධෛර්යයමත් කළ යුතුයි.” නික් එසේ පවසනවා.

බලාපොරොත්තුවේ පණිවුඩය

“මම විශ්වාස කරනවා කුමන හෝ දෙයක් සිදුවන්නේ කිසියම් හේතුවක් නිසා බව. මොන දේ සිදු වුණත් ජීවිතය අතහරින්න එපා. ඔබ ඔබේ උපරිමයෙන් උත්සාහ කර දෙවියන් කෙරෙහි විශ්වාසය තැබීම කළ යුතුයි. මම වැඩුණේ මෙවන් සංකල්පයක් සිතේ තබාගෙනයි. මට නොතිබූ දේවල් වලට වඩා මා සතුව තිබූ දේවල් වලට මම ස්තූතිවන්ත වුණා. අපට සමහර අවස්ථාවල ආශ්චර්යයක් වෙනුවෙන් බලා ඉන්නට සිදු වෙනවා. නමුත් එවැනි ආශ්චර්යයන් සිදු නොවන අවස්ථා තිබෙනවා. මමත් මගේ ජීවිතයේ බොහෝ දේවල් වෙනස් වේයැයි බලාපොරොත්තු වුණා. එසේ සිදු නොවුණත් තවත් කෙනෙකුගේ ජීවිතයට ආශ්චර්යයක් ගෙන එන්නට හැකි වීමම මට ජීවත් වීමේ වටිනාකමක් ඇති කළා.”

කැනායි මියහරා

nick vujicic biography in tamil

නික් සහ කැනායි (INSBRIGHT)

නික් විවාහකයි. ජපන් ඇමරිකානු සම්භවයක් ඇති ඔහුගේ බිරිය කැනායි මියහරා (Kanae Miyahara) ඔහුට මුණගැසෙන්නේ ටෙක්සාස්හිදීයි. එය දුටු මුල්ම මොහොතේ ඇති වූ ප්‍රේමයක් බව නික් පවසනවා. ඔවුන් දෙදෙනාට කියෝෂි ජේම්ස් වුයිචිච් සහ ඩේජාන් ලීවයි වුයිචිච් නමින් දරුවන් දෙදෙනෙකු සිටිනවා.

nick vujicic biography in tamil

නික්, කැනායි සහ දරුවන් (puntuit)

අත් පා නැතත් නික් ගොල්ෆ්, පාපන්දු, පිහිනීම, හිම මත ලිස්සීම, ගුවන් කරණම් සහ surfing වැනි ක්‍රීඩා වල නියැලෙනවා. ඔහුගේ වම් උකුලේ කුඩා පාදයක් පිහිටා ඇති අතර සමබරතාවය පවත්වා ගැනීමට එය බොහෝ උපකාර වනවා. පහර එල්ල කිරීමටත්, ටයිප් කිරීමේදීත්, ලිවීමේදීත්, යම් යම් දේවල් ඔසවා තබා ගැනීමටත් ඔහු මෙම කුඩා පාදය භාවිතා කරනවා.

ඔහුගේ පළමු කෘතිය වන ‘ Life Without Limits: Inspiration for a Ridiculously Good Life’   2010 වර්ෂයේදී ප්‍රකාශයට පත් කෙරුණා . ‘Life’s Greater Purpose’ DVD පටය 2005දී එළිදැක්වූ අතර එහි ඔහුගේ එදිනෙදා ජීවිතය සහ ක්‍රියාකාරකම් අඩංගුයි. 2005දී නික් වසරේ හොඳම තරුණ ඕස්ට්‍රේලියානුවාට හිමි සම්මානය වෙනුවෙන් නම් කෙරුණා.

The Butterfly Circus

2009දී නික් රංගනයෙන් දායක වුණු The Butterfly Circus කෙටි චිත්‍රපටය Doorpost Film Project හි හොඳම චිත්‍රපටය වූ අතර එය Method Fest Film Festival හි හොඳම කෙටි චිත්‍රපටයට හිමි සම්මානයද දිනා ගත්තා. නික්ට ඒ වෙනුවෙන් හොඳම නළුවාට හිමි සම්මානයද ලැබුණා. හොලිවුඩ්හි The Feel Good Film Festival හිදි එම චිත්‍රපටයටම 2010දී හොඳම කෙටි චිත්‍රපටයට හිමි සම්මානය ලැබුණා.

අත්නොහැරි ජීවිතය

ආත්ම විශ්වාසය නික් වෙත නිසඟයෙන් උරුම වූවක් නොවේ. උපතින් ලද අසම්පූර්ණ ශරීරය නිසා කුඩා කළ පටන්ම බොහෝ අපහසුතාවයන්ට මුහුණ දෙන්නට සිදු වුවත් අවසානයේදී සියල්ල පවතින අයුරින් පිළිගැනීමට ඔහු ඉගෙන ගත්තා. නික් ඔහුගේ ප්‍රශ්න විසඳාගැනීමට මුලින්ම කළේ දෙවියන් කෙරෙහි විශ්වාසය තැබීම බව පවසනවා. වර්තමානයේ තමන් පැමිණ සිටින තත්ත්වයට ඒමට පවුල සහ මිතුරන්ද මහත් ලෙස උපකාර කළ බවත් පවසන නික් ‍මේ වන විට ලේඛකයෙක්, සංගීතඥයෙක්, රංගන ශිල්පියෙක් ලෙස කටයුතු කර තිබෙනවා. පිහිනීම, මසුන් ඇල්ලීම, චිත්‍ර ඇඳීම වැනි දේවල්ද ඔහුගේ විනෝදාංශ ලැයිස්තුවේ ඇතුළත්.

Nick Vujicic is a renowned Australian-American Christian evangelist and motivational speaker born with tetra-amelia syndrome, a rare disorder experienced by the absence of arms and legs.

Although he was born a healthy baby, Nick had no arms and legs. He basically had two small feet, one of which had two toes. Due to his physical disability, Nick delayed attending school as the Victoria state law barred him despite being mentally okay.

However, after the law was changed, he was among the first physically disabled students to join a mainstream school. This was not the end of his troubles. His lack of limbs made him a target for school bullies a situation that had him deeply depressed.

At the age of eight, he thought of suicide and later tried to drown himself in his bathtub at the age of 10. For the love of his parents, Nick gave it a second thought and got himself from the dark scenario.

He always prayed hard that God would give him arms and legs. He even told God that if this prayer went unanswered, then he would not praise him indefinitely.

He gradually had a way to live fully without limbs, adapting many of the daily tasks limbed people accomplish. In this spirit, he learned to write with two toes on his left foot, having a special grip that slid onto his big toe. He even knows how to use a computer and can type up to 45 words within a minute using the “heel and toe” method.

Other essential things that he learned include; throwing a tennis ball, playing drums, getting a glass of water, combing his hair, brushing his teeth, shaving, and answering the phone.

During his high school life, he was even voted captain of MacGregor State in Queensland where he worked with the student council on fundraising events for disability and charity campaigns.

At the age of 17, he started giving talks to his prayer group, a trait that led him to become a seasoned motivational speaker. In addition, he founded Life Without Limbs, a non-profit organization in 2005. later in 2007, Nick founded Attitude is Attitude, a secular motivational speaking company.

Elsewhere, he featured in the short film, The Butterfly Circus. This later had him recognized at the 2010 Method Fest Independent Film Festival as the Best Actor in a short film for his starring role as Will.

Nick was born in Melbourne, Australia in 1982. He was born with a disorder known as tetra-amelia syndrome, a rare condition that leaves the newborn without limbs.

From the first day he was born, he faced the realities of a hard world. His own mother struggled with his condition, and refused to hold him as a newborn.

It took his family some time to come to terms with his condition. They left the hospital as soon as they could, to avoid the unwanted attention caused by Nick’s condition.

The family struggled with Nick’s condition at first, but they eventually realized they had to deal with it, and raise their young child as best as they could.

Nick’s parents would go on to encourage him to be optimistic, and look for the silver lining in all-things. Of course, he would struggle with his peers because of how he looked.

He would even get bullied and mocked from time to time. The teasing strengthened Vujicic, but, it almost killed him. Especially when Nick considered what perceived as a hopeless future, where he’d never be able to hold a job, have a family, or get married.

In fact, when Vujicic was just 10 years old he considered taking his own life. He attempted to drown himself in his bathtub. But, the thought of how much it would pain his parents to take his own life, on top of the fact that they already had child born with such challenges, caused him to opt out.

Change Of Heart

As Vujicic grew older, he began to see the light. For years he was bitter, and angry at the world and God for his condition. Often times crying out to God, begging him for a miracle, that his arms and legs might reappear.

But, after stumbling across a specific chapter (chapter 9) in the Gospel of John, he had a change of heart. Instead of being angry and upset because of his situation, he started to look at the purpose behind his challenges.

He realized that much of his suffering was due to his attitude , the incorrect assessment of his value, and his perceived limitations. He found a new hope.

Thus, as a teenager he began sharing his message of hope, purpose, and the benefits of resilience with people at his school. He then began giving inspirational speeches at schools and events throughout his community.

A Star Is Born

Once Nick Vujicic accepted the truth of his value, the truth of his purpose, and the truth of his destiny, a star was truly born.

Nick’s change of heart opened up all sorts of opportunities for him. His message and his empowering mindset became infectious to all who would listen.

nick vujicic story quote

Before he knew it, Nick was being asked to give speeches not just across town, but across the country. Then, across the ocean, then the world.

Nick’s courage and tenacity for life would help him become one of the most in-demand and successful motivational speakers in modern-history. He’s since travelled to 78 countries and counting, has presented on over 3,500 different stages, and touched the hearts of hundreds of millions of people.

He’s also become a best-selling author of multiple books , a family-man with four children and a beautiful wife, and has started his own international non-profit ministry, Life Without Limbs.

On top of it all, he managed to become a multimillionaire, achieving an estimated net worth of approximately 2.5 million. It’s safe to say, Vujicic has achieved massive success.

Introduction

Disability is not inability.

This is the story of a great person, Nicholas James Nick Vujicic, who stands as an inspiration to other people with his great qualities that is faith, will power and perseverance. Even though he is a disabled person his disability has not stopped him from doing what he has wanted to do. Nick Vujicic was born on 4 December 1982 in Melbourne, Australia with a rare disability called Phocomelia characterised by the absence of all four limbs. 

Overcoming depression 

Nick has a small foot on his left hip. It gives him balance and enables him to kick. With his foot, he writes with a pen and picks things up between his toes. He also plays golf with a heavy stick tucked under his chin. He is a huge fan of the English Premier League. His parents did their best to make him independent from the start. His father gave him the courage to learn how to swim by putting him in water at 18 months. His mother invented a special plastic device to enable him to hold a pen and pencil. 

Nick’s achievements

He believes that challenges strengthen our opinions. With the help of his religion, friends and family, Nick becomes an international symbol of triumph over adversity. Nick won the Australian Young Citizen of the Year award in 1990 for his bravery and perseverance. His persistence made him achieve a degree in Financial Planning and Real Estate. He went to Hawaii in 2008 and was trained in surfing by Bethany Hamilton. Nick was on the cover of Surfer magazine with his feat of doing the 360-degree spins. He is able to do this feat because of his low centre of gravity. 

Nick and Kanae Miyahara, whose mother was a Mexican and father was a Japanese, got married on February 12, 2012 and on February 13, 2013 they were blessed with the birth of a healthy baby boy with full body.
